I stumbled into Eli on my way back to the van. There was Darcy, in a pair of swimming trunks that were too big for her, and a sugary-pink tank top that had to belong to Chelsea, her arms held above her head by Cash.

His eyes were dark, narrowed, as she struggled and fought his grip. I nearly dropped the bag of donuts I held in my hand when Cash let her go with a sigh.

“No, no that’s not how you break my grip,” he said as she put her hands on her hips.

“Well, how am I supposed to do it when you hold me like that?” she shot back. I glanced up at Eli.

“Self-defense classes?” He looked amused. The three oldest of our pack had served over in Europe during WW2, but they didn’t talk about it much. The only one who even bore scars from their tour in the military was Cash, and that’s because he had been away from the heartstone for a good three years before returning home. Finn and Eli had healed up fine although, personally, I thought they still had some mental scars from the war. They pretended like it was so long ago they barely remembered it, but we all knew it was a bad idea to sneak up on Eli while he slept, and that Finn got a bit hoarder-y about food. And Cash… well, we never talked about the scars on his back.

“Try again,” Cash said, lunging for Darcy. She yelped and stumbled backward as he snagged her around the waist. Her hand slammed toward his cheek, and he dodged the blow. He hauled her over his shoulder and she kicked her legs. When it was clear she wasn’t escaping, he set her down with a sigh.

Eli grabbed my arm to stop me from marching up to Cash to tell him off. He was being too tough on her. Nothing was ever going to hurt her. She was always going to have us to protect her. So what did she need self-defense for? Jake had been taken care of, and we were staying on the move so much that I didn’t think that hunters were going to be much of a problem… as long as we stayed moving.

“Again,” Darcy demanded, and this time when Cash went for her, she brought her hands up. Thunder crackled and there was a burst of light so bright I had to clap my hands over my eyes. When I blinked the spots away from my vision, Cash was on the ground, laying on his back. Darcy stood over him, hands out stretched, her eyes wide.

“Oh shit, oh shit!” She fell to her knees and shook him by the shoulders. Eli dropped his grip on me and we raced over. Cash’s eyes were shut tight and he grunted.

“Fuck,” he groaned, lifting a hand to push Darcy away. “Ow, fuck, stop, I’m fine.” I stared down at him as his eyes cracked open. Darcy sat back on her haunches, her fingers going to brush over her lips, as if she was horrified.
